
The Greater Bengaluru Authority (GBA) is conducting the 'My e-Khata, My Hakku' campaign on May 23, 2026, across multiple Bengaluru locations under the Bhoo Guarantee scheme. The initiative aims to facilitate e-Khata issuance, conversion of b-Khata to a-Khata, mutation processing, and error rectification in property records. Since its launch, over 23 lakh e-Khatas have been issued, with thousands of applications processed or pending. The campaign includes help desks and digital facilities to assist property owners in resolving tax and record issues.
